Center/Harmon Intersection

Map of Harmon Ave and Center St Concept; intersection is blue with overlay of new lane layout

What is this Project?

Intersection improvements and signalization, including pedestrian signals. 

Why is It Important?

This intersection is currently unsignalized, and traffic on Center Street is uncontrolled. There are high numbers of pedestrians crossing Center street, high numbers of left turn movements from Center Street to the Harmon Parking Garage on the University campus and numerous buses that travel through the intersection. Signalization will allow for a more orderly movement of traffic, a safer environment for pedestrians and will allow the Razorback Transit buses to navigate the intersection more easily.

What is the Current Status?

Updated 10/5/2022

McClelland Consulting Engineers, Inc. was selected to design the improvements to this intersection. The design and land acquisition are complete. A bid opening was held on April 5, 2022. On May 3rd, the City Council approved a contract with NEC, Inc. for the construction of this project. Construction is underway.

When Will it be Completed?

Updated 06/01/2023

Construction was expected to be complete by February 2023. The contractor has experienced some utility delays. The project will likely be completed by the end of July 2023.

How is it Funded?

Funding for the project comes from the Bond issue that voters approved in April 2019.
